Here we report primers targeting 10 microsatellite loci of dinoflagellates in the genus Symbiodinium (clade B1/B184) symbiotic with the Caribbean sea fan coral, Gorgonia ventalina. Primers were tested on 12 Symbiodinium B1/B184 cultures, as well as 40 genomic DNA extracts of G. ventalina tissue samples. All loci were polymorphic with allelic richness ranging from 4-16. Gene diversity ranged from 0.15 to 0.91. These primers provide powerful tools for examining the fine-scale population structure and dynamics of Symbiodinium within a single host species.
